A sports car starts from rest on a circular track of radius 537 meter. The car's speed increases at the constant rate of 0.780 m/s2. At the point where the magnitudes of the tangential and centripetal accelerations are same, determine the following:

(a) Calculate the speed of the sports car?

m/s

(b) Calculate the distance traveled?

m

(c) Calculate the elapsed time?

s
